Full job description
The Colerain Chamber of Commerce, an 11-year-old organization dedicated to fostering business and community vitality, is seeking a dynamic and visionary President/CEO to lead our Chamber into its next phase of growth. The President/CEO serves as the face of the Chamber, responsible for advancing our mission through servant leadership, integrity and a growth mindset. This role oversees all aspects of Chamber operations, including membership growth and engagement, financial management, event and program development, and community partnerships. The President/CEO will ensure an excellent membership experience while building strong relationships across business, civic, and community sectors. The ideal candidate is a community-minded leader who thrives on connecting people and ideas, driving strategic initiatives, inspiring collaboration, and implementing plans. With exceptional communication and relationship-building skills, the President/CEO will serve as a trusted partner to the board of directors and members, as well as a respected advocate for the Colerain business community.
Culture
The Colerain Chamber of Commerce is a young, energetic organization (11 years strong) with a culture of service, celebration, and connection. We proudly support local businesses, schools, nonprofits, government partners, and individuals across the Tri-State region. With hallmark events like Hometown Hero and the Annual Business Awards, an active volunteer board, and membership retention above 80%, our Chamber is thriving and community-minded making it an exciting place to lead and grow.
Responsibilities
Key Responsibilities
Implement the vision and goals set by the Board of Directors, ensuring alignment with the Chamber s mission and values.
Serve as the visible leader and face of the Chamber, building strong, trusted relationships with members, the Board, business leaders, schools, government officials, and community partners.
Drive membership growth and retention by delivering meaningful value, strengthening engagement, and leading new member initiatives.
Oversee the Chamber s financial health, including budgeting, reporting, and sustainable revenue generation to support operations and growth.
Lead the planning, execution, and evaluation of Chamber programs, events, and services, ensuring they provide exceptional value to members and the community.
Guide and collaborate with staff, volunteers, and committees to deliver successful initiatives such as Women s Networking, Colerain H.O.P.E., Sales Summit, Team Up to Green Up, C.A.F.E., the Golf League, and other member programs.
Evaluate operations, programs, and staff performance to identify opportunities for improvement, innovation, and cost-effectiveness.
Represent and promote the Chamber at community events, meetings, and through media, serving as a convener between businesses, government, schools, and residents.
Serve as lead administrator for the Colerain Chamber Foundation (501(c)(3)) and oversee compliance, programming, and partnership opportunities.
Negotiate and manage contracts, partnerships, and agreements on behalf of the Chamber.
Prepare and present reports, articles, speeches, and updates to inform and engage stakeholders.
